SCA Ladies climb up to third

Baggies beat Foxes to secure third straight win

SPORTING Club Albion Ladies climbed into third place in the Women’s Northern Division after an impressive 3-0 victory at league strugglers Leicester yesterday.

A first-half brace from Abbie Pope and a second-half own goal secured the Baggies’ third successive win.

Baggies boss Dave Lawrence is currently coaching in Africa with the Albion Foundation, so Albion Ladies’ first team coaches Lee Wood and Richard Holmes took charge against the Foxes.

Wood said: “We controlled the game from start to finish and Leicester never looked like threatening us.

“Although the pitch did not suit our style of play, we adapted and took control.”

He was also delighted to see the return to action of Kayleigh Griffiths as she came on in the 82nd minute after being out injured for more than six months with a broken leg.

“It was great to see Kayleigh back on the pitch," he added.

“She has worked really hard with many people at SCA to get back.”

Sporting Club Albion host Blackburn Rovers on Sunday (ko 2pm).
